Исключить файлы из "checkJS" - PullRequest
0 голосов
/ 13 июня 2018

Могу ли я как-то исключить выделенные файлы из настройки VSCodes "javascript.implicitProjectConfig.checkJs": true?

Я бы не хотел проверять сборки моего веб-пакета, которые все помещены в папку dist.

Я знаю, что мог бы добавить **/dist/* или **/dist к files.exclude, но это (по определению) полностью скрыло бы их от проводника файлов, а это не то, что мне нужно, так как я хотел бы иметь возможность проверять их извремя от времени.

Вот как выглядит пример моей установки:

enter image description here

My jsconfig.js выглядит так:

{
    "compilerOptions": {
        "target": "es5",
        "checkJs": true
    },
    "include": [
        "**/src/**/*"
    ]
}

В моем понимании не стоит проверять файлы в dist, во-первых ...

1 Ответ

0 голосов
/ 13 июня 2018

Я только что понял, что это произошло, поскольку я дважды включил checkJs:

  • In jsconfig.json
  • В настройках рабочего пространства через "javascript.implicitProjectConfig.checkJs": true

После удаления "javascript.implicitProjectConfig.checkJs": true из настроек все работает как положено и проверяются только файлы в папках src ...

...